Three Staff from HEI Earn Licenses
Houston Engineering, Inc. (HEI) congratulates the following staff on earning professional licenses: Patrick Johanneck earned his Professional Land Surveyor (PLS) license for Minnesota; Paul LeClaire earned his Professional Engineer (PE) license for North Dakota; Bennett Uhler earned his PE for North Dakota. They all work in HEI’s Fargo office. Patrick Johanneck joined HEI in 2010 and serves as a Land Surveyor I completing various surveys for HEI’s private and public clients across the region. His duties include drafting and surveying as well as construction inspection, cross section, topographic control, construction staking, and legal boundary surveys. Outside of work, Patrick enjoys spending time with family and friends, hunting and fishing, and watching and reading about sports. Paul LeClaire joined HEI in 2015 and serves as an Engineer II supporting clients with in-depth modeling efforts, assisting with drainage improvements, culvert installations, watershed planning, and more. Outside of work, Paul enjoys spending time with friends and family, shooting pool, biking, and camping. Bennett Uhler joined HEI in 2014 and serves as an Engineer II providing water resource services in urban settings with a focus on flood protection, stormwater management, and underground utilities. He is experienced in stormwater design and has worked on a variety of projects in the Fargo-Moorhead area. He also performs all duties in site observation for new developments. Outside of work, Bennett enjoys spending time with his wife Alexis, completing miscellaneous projects around their home, and playing softball when the weather cooperates.
